Wheat Collapses Lower on Friday
Yahoo Finance· 2026-03-20 22:04
Market Performance - The wheat complex experienced downward pressure across all three markets, with Chicago SRW futures down 12 to 13 1/2 cents, and May futures falling 18 ½ cents [1] - KC HRW futures closed down 21 to 21 1/2 cents, with May futures down 23 ¾ cents for the week [1] - MPLS spring wheat saw declines of 10 ¾ to 15 3/4 cents in the front months, with May slipping back 17 ½ cents from the previous Friday [1] CFTC Data - CFTC data indicated a reduction of 9,643 contracts from the CBT wheat spec net short position, bringing the net short to 12,702 contracts as of Tuesday [2] - In KC wheat futures and options, managed money increased their net long position by 1,301 contracts, totaling 10,729 contracts [2] Export Commitments - USDA's Export Sales data reported wheat export commitments at 23.853 million metric tons (MMT), reflecting a 14% increase from the previous year [3] - This figure represents 97% of the USDA's export projection of 900 million bushels (mbu) and is slightly behind the 99% average sales pace [3] - Shipment data is ahead of schedule at 19.279 MMT, which is 78% of USDA's forecast compared to the 76% average pace [3] Closing Prices - On May 26, CBOT Wheat closed at $5.95 1/4, down 12 3/4 cents; July 26 CBOT Wheat closed at $6.07 1/4, down 12 1/4 cents [4] - May 26 KCBT Wheat closed at $6.06 1/4, down 21 cents; July 26 KCBT Wheat closed at $6.21 1/4, down 21 cents [4] - May 26 MIAX Wheat closed at $6.28, down 15 3/4 cents; July 26 MIAX Wheat closed at $6.42 3/4, down 15 3/4 cents [4]
Wheat Falling Lower on Monday
Yahoo Finance· 2026-03-16 17:17
Market Overview - The wheat complex is experiencing losses, with Chicago SRW futures down by 11 to 12 cents, KC HRW futures down by 8 to 9 cents, and MPLS spring wheat down by 7 to 9 cents [1] Export Data - Export inspections data indicated that 343,022 MT (12.6 million bushels) of wheat were shipped in the week ending March 2, representing a decrease of 31.2% from the previous week and 30.81% from the same week last year [2] - Mexico was the leading destination for wheat exports, receiving 79,566 MT, followed by the Philippines with 62,647 MT and Bangladesh with 56,699 MT [2] - Total marketing year shipments have reached 19.47 MMT (715.4 million bushels), which is an increase of 18.67% year-over-year [2] Commitment of Traders Data - Managed money reduced their net short position in CBT wheat futures and options by 3,455 contracts, bringing the total to 22,345 contracts as of Tuesday [3] - In KC wheat futures and options, speculators were net long 9,425 contracts, an increase of 7,559 contracts week-over-week [3] - In MPLS spring wheat, spec funds increased their long positions by 12,027 contracts, resulting in a net long of 15,990 contracts [3] Current Wheat Prices - As of the latest data, May 26 CBOT Wheat is priced at $6.02 1/4, down 11 1/2 cents; July 26 CBOT Wheat is at $6.13, down 11 1/2 cents; May 26 KCBT Wheat is at $6.21 1/2, down 8 1/2 cents; July 26 KCBT Wheat is at $6.35 1/4, down 8 1/2 cents; May 26 MIAX Wheat is at $6.37 1/4, down 8 1/4 cents; July 26 MIAX Wheat is at $6.52, down 7 1/4 cents [3]
Wheat Trading Lower on Monday
Yahoo Finance· 2026-01-26 18:21
Market Overview - The wheat complex is experiencing losses at the start of the week, with Chicago SRW futures down by 5 to 7 cents, KC HRW futures down by 7 to 9 cents, and MPLS spring wheat down by 3 to 4 cents [1] Export Data - The Export Inspections report indicated that 351,001 MT (12.9 million bushels) of wheat were shipped in the week of January 22, which is 11.76% lower than the previous week and 27.56% lower than the same week last year. South Korea was the largest destination, receiving 119,036 MT, followed by Japan with 73,230 MT and Mexico with 63,773 MT. The total for the marketing year now stands at 16.33 MMT (600.05 million bushels), which is 18.21% higher than the same period last year [2] Sales Commitments - USDA Export Sales data reported 21.03 MMT of wheat commitments by January 15, which is 18% above last year and represents 86% of the USDA's projected sales, close to the average sales pace of 87% [3] Trader Positions - Commitment of Traders data revealed that managed money increased their net short position by 4,471 contracts as of January 20, bringing the total net short position for CBT wheat to 110,700 contracts. In KC wheat, speculators were net short by 13,018 contracts, with a slight increase of 237 contracts for the week [4] Current Prices - As of the publication date, the following wheat futures prices were noted: - Mar 26 CBOT Wheat at $5.22 1/2, down 7 cents - May 26 CBOT Wheat at $5.33 1/4, down 5 3/4 cents - Mar 26 KCBT Wheat at $5.32, down 8 3/4 cents - May 26 KCBT Wheat at $5.42 3/4, down 7 3/4 cents - Mar 26 MIAX Wheat at $5.71 3/4, down 3 1/4 cents - May 26 MIAX Wheat at $5.83 1/2, down 3 1/4 cents [4]
